Solutions for Solar Panel Waste Are Just Beginning to Surface

Just last year, the U.S. startup SolarCycle launched with the specific mission to refurbish modules and recycle solar panel waste — promising to extract 95 percent of the high-value metals in solar photovoltaic panels. This includes silver, silicon, copper and aluminum, which could be repurposed for other uses or infused back into future panels.

Solar energy and the environment

However, producing and using solar energy technologies may have some environmental affects. Solar energy technologies require materials, such as metals and glass, that are energy intensive to make. The environmental issues related to producing these materials could be associated with solar energy systems.
